Chateau Bauduc is a private wine estate in Creon, a busy market town roughly halfway between Bordeaux and St Emilion. The chateau is a beautiful nineteenth century stone building, complete with twin turrets and a colonnaded south front, with lovely views from the terrace across a striking valley. The vineyards, which cover a third of the 250 acres, surround the chateau and the buildings where we make, age and bottle the wine and there is a charming farmhouse which we rent out throughout the year. We grow Merlot, Cabernet Sauvignon, Cabernet Franc and some Malbec grapes for our ‘Appellation Controlee’ Premieres Cotes de Bordeaux and Bordeaux Superieur red wines and for our Bordeaux Rose. Our dry white wines are made from Sauvignon Blanc and Semillon vines. All our revenues go into improving the wine, the vineyards, the equipment, the premises, the team and the service we give.
